If I had to describe the color, it's like shade 4 Cassel Brick but with a brown tint added, making it a deeper color. When applied to the lips, it shows up as a red-brown with a stronger red undertone. While it's generally the deepest shade in this line, it's not overwhelmingly dark when actually applied, which I found quite nice. It can even look somewhat subdued depending on how you view it. Recently, deep undertone colors have been trendy, so when we talk about brown lips, many tend to have grayish or dull undertones. However, this Scarlet Brown doesn't have any grayish or dull tints - it's a brown lip color with a decent level of saturation. Although it's a velvet lipstick, it doesn't apply thickly or with intense pigmentation like other velvet lips. Instead, it goes on thinly and sheerly. You can build up the color with multiple applications, but due to its thin and sheer nature, it doesn't become extremely deep or intense. If you're like me and want to use it as a base or prefer a thin, sheer color payoff, you'll love this lipstick. The application feels a bit stiff at first, but after applying it once or twice, it glides on smoothly. It smudges well, and while it wears off like any lipstick when eating, it leaves less residue on straws compared to other velvet lipsticks when drinking. The scent is the same caramel popcorn fragrance as the recently released Double Layer Over Velvet. This is just personal preference, but I personally prefer lipsticks where the lipstick and stick guard are tightly connected, like Rom&nd's Zero Matte Lipstick or Peripera's Ink Mood Matte Stick. As someone who loves matte lips, I find that matte lipsticks often break when using them. Especially products shaped like this Black Rouge lipstick are more prone to breaking. That's why I usually bought lipsticks in the style of Ink Mood Matte Stick when I wanted a lipstick over a tint, but I fell for this one because of its pretty color... Also, because it applies thinly and sheerly, those who are used to highly pigmented lipsticks might find it too light on the first application. Lastly, it has the same caramel popcorn scent as the Double Layer Over Velvet, so be cautious if you dislike this fragrance.
